Great Lakes Rodeo this weekend

MARQUETTE — The 14th annual Great Lakes Rodeo takes place Friday through Sunday at the Marquette County Fairgrounds.

In advance, tickets are $10 for adults per day or $20 for the weekend, and $5 for children or $10 for the weekend.

At the gate, tickets are $12 for adults and $22 for the weekend pass and $7 for children and $12 for a weekend pass for children ages 6-12.

The gates open at 10 a.m. Friday, with the Miss Great Lakes Rodeo Pageant at 5 p.m., with barrel racing at 6 p.m. and youth rodeo practice at 7 p.m.

Saturday, the gates open at 8 a.m., with a 9 a.m. start for round robin team roping and breakaway roping. A kickball tournament begins at 11 a.m. as does a Battle of the Bands.

A noon, the Jack Pot Speed Show starts, with the youth rodeo at 1 p.m. and the first rodeo performance at 7 p.m. A barn dance begins at 9:30 p.m.

Dads are admitted for free on Sunday when accompanying the family. Also Sunday, the theme is Paint the Stands Pink for Breast Cancer, with gates opening at 8 a.m., round robin team roping and breakaway roping at 9 a.m. Then, Cowboy Church is at 10 a.m., with the kickball finals at 11 a.m., pony pulls at noon and the second rodeo performance at 3 p.m.
